Wings of Blue take first and second place at nationals
November 2, 2012
The U.S. Air Force's parachute team, the Wings of Blue, placed first and second in the U.S. Parachuting Association Nationals Competition's 4-Way Formation Skydiving (Advanced Category) event this week. The Air Force Paradigm team took first place, the Air Force Legacy team placed second.  From left to right: Members of the Air Force Legacy team, Cadets 1st Class Kyle Land, Brett Brunner, Travis Grindstaff, Jeremy Krohngold; members of the Air Force Paradigm team, Cadets 1st Class John Skeele, Erin Brown, Dustin Weeks and Dani Griffith. JBSA-Randolph community learns importance of fire prevention
October 18, 2012
Nathan Hascall, a pre-school student at the Child Development Center, dons fire fighters’ personal protective equipment Oct. 9 at Joint Base San Antonio-Randolph. Fire Prevention Week was established to commemorate the Great Chicago Fire, the tragic 1871 conflagration that killed more than 250 people, left 100,000 homeless, destroyed more than 17,400 structures and burned more than 2,000 acres. The fire began Oct. 8, but continued into and did most of its damage Oct. 9, 1871. (U.S. Air Force photo by Benjamin Faske)
